diff --git a/server/src/bin/lesavka-uvc.rs b/server/src/bin/lesavka-uvc.rs index 74940b7..ef42745 100644 --- a/server/src/bin/lesavka-uvc.rs +++ b/server/src/bin/lesavka-uvc.rs @@ -128,7 +128,7 @@ fn main() -> Result<()> { if rc < 0 { let err = std::io::Error::last_os_error(); match err.raw_os_error() { - Some(libc::EAGAIN) | Some(libc::EINTR) => { + Some(libc::EAGAIN) | Some(libc::EINTR) | Some(libc::ENOENT) => { thread::sleep(Duration::from_millis(10)); continue; }